■59153 / ) |
Re[3]: C#でtxtファイルの操作 |
□投稿者/ マサヤ (319回)-(2011/05/17(Tue) 15:00:12)
|
OpenFileDialogは存在するのですが、
>別のテキストファイルに保存
については、固定のファイルなのでしょうか?
1. 指定ファイルを読み取り
2. 保存文字をメモリに保存
3. 別ファイルに2.の保存文字を記載、保存
でしょうか?
また、書き込むファイルは常に新規ファイルですか?更新ファイルになりますか?
ちなみに、ここについては
>StreamReader sr = new StreamReader(file, Encoding.GetEncoding("SHIFT_JIS"));
>while (sr.EndOfStream == false)
>{
>
>string line = sr.ReadLine();
>
>
>textBox1.Text += line + "\r\n";
>
>}
>sr.Close();
下記のほうが、楽です。
using(StreamReader sr = new StreamReader(file, Encoding.GetEncoding("SHIFT_JIS")))
{
while (sr.EndOfStream == false)
{
string line = sr.ReadLine();
textBox1.Text += line + "\r\n";
}
}
|
|